1. 关闭Oracle服务
在重启Oracle服务之前,首先需要关闭当前正在运行的Oracle服务。可以通过以下步骤完成:
1.1. 停止监听器
在Linux命令行中,使用以下命令停止监听器:
$ lsnrctl stop
这将停止Oracle监听器的运行。
1.2. 停止数据库实例
在Linux命令行中,使用以下命令停止Oracle数据库实例:
$ sqlplus / as sysdba
SQL> shutdown immediate
这将立即关闭Oracle数据库实例。
2. 重启Oracle服务
当Oracle服务关闭后,可以进行重新启动。以下是在Linux下重启Oracle服务的步骤:
2.1. 启动数据库实例
在Linux命令行中,使用以下命令启动Oracle数据库实例:
$ sqlplus / as sysdba
SQL> startup
这将启动Oracle数据库实例。
2.2. 启动监听器
在Linux命令行中,使用以下命令启动Oracle监听器:
$ lsnrctl start
这将启动Oracle监听器。
3. 确认服务是否成功重启
在完成Oracle服务的重启后,可以通过以下步骤来确认服务是否成功重启:
3.1. 连接数据库
在Linux命令行中,使用以下命令连接到Oracle数据库实例:
$ sqlplus / as sysdba
输入上述命令后,可以看到Oracle数据库实例的命令行提示符。
3.2. 检查监听器状态
在Linux命令行中,使用以下命令检查Oracle监听器的状态:
$ lsnrctl status
执行上述命令后,将显示Oracle监听器的状态信息。确认状态为 已启动 表示监听器成功重启。
通过上述步骤,您可以成功地重启Oracle服务,并确认服务是否成功重启。请注意,在执行重启操作之前,应该先备份数据库以防止数据丢失。